The Role of Office Interior Design in Business Success
Modern organizations understand that a well-designed office boosts creativity, fosters collaboration, and improves employee well-being. A smart office interior design reflects the values of the business and supports different working styles—from quiet zones for focused work to open spaces for team collaboration.
Incorporating ergonomic furniture, natural lighting, and calming colors in the office interior design can help reduce stress and fatigue, leading to better job performance. Additionally, features like breakout areas, relaxation zones, and biophilic elements (such as indoor plants and natural materials) create a more engaging and pleasant work environment.
Designing for Flexibility and Function
As businesses evolve, so do their workspace needs. A successful office interior design must be flexible, allowing for future growth, technological changes, and hybrid working models. Movable walls, modular furniture, and multi-purpose meeting rooms are now common elements in office spaces.
Moreover, technology plays a key role in modern office interior design. Smart lighting, integrated charging stations, digital whiteboards, and soundproof booths are being added to enhance the user experience and improve efficiency.
Branding Through Interior Design
Office interior design is also a way to communicate your brand’s identity. A cohesive design that aligns with your company’s logo, values, and culture helps employees feel more connected and leaves a strong impression on visitors and clients. Whether you prefer a minimalist style, an industrial look, or a vibrant creative environment, the design should tell your brand story.
